雷贝拉唑钠树脂复合物的制备及评价  被引量:2

摘  要:目的制备雷贝拉唑钠树脂复合物,探讨其形成机理并考察其稳定性。方法用静态离子交换法制备雷贝拉唑钠树脂复合物,通过正交设计法优化处方制备工艺;通过光学显微镜观察药物树脂复合物的形态外观;通过X-ray衍射分析、差示扫描量热分析以及红外光谱分析探讨药物树脂复合物的形成机理;通过吸湿平衡曲线评价雷贝拉唑钠树脂复合物的防潮性能;通过破坏性实验评价雷贝拉唑钠树脂复合物的耐酸性能。结果优化所得最佳制备工艺:药物初始浓度为1.0g·L^(-1),药物树脂质量比为1︰3,溶液介质离子强度为0.001mol·L^(-1)的氢氧化钠溶液,制备温度为30℃。经红外光谱分析、X-ray衍射和DSC分析,药物树脂复合物所载药物是以化学键的形式结合到离子交换树脂上的。雷贝拉唑钠树脂复合物也具有一定的防潮和耐酸性能。结论雷贝拉唑钠树脂复合物是通过化学键形成的,且在一定程度上能够提高药物的稳定性。Objective To confirm the formation mechanism of the sodium rabeprazole-resinate complex,and assess its stability.Methods The sodium rabeprazole-resinate complex was prepared by using ion exchange resin(IER)as a carrier,and the formulations were optimized by an orthogonal design.The sodium rabeprazole-resinate complex was characterized by morphology which was observed using an optical microscope.X-ray diffraction,differential scanning calorimetry and FTIR were employed to confirm the formation mechanism of the sodium rabeprazole-resinate complex.Under different humidity environments,the moisture proof capability of the sodium rabeprazole-resinate complex was investigated.Under the conditions of different acid and alkali,the acid resistance of the sodium rabeprazole-resinate complex was investigated.Result The drug concentration that prepared the sodium rabeprazole-resinate complex was 1.0g·L^-1,and the ratio of drug and resin was 1︰3.The ion strength of NaOH was0.001mol·L^-1,and the preparation temperature was 30 ℃.By X-ray diffraction analysis,differential scanning calorimetry and FTIR,the drug in sodium rabeprazole-resinate complex was combined with ion-exchange resins by chemical bond.The moisture absorption-liquefaction problem of sodium rabeprazole was alleviated to some extent.Conclusion The drug in sodium rabeprazoleresinate complex was combined with ion-exchange resins by chemical bond,and the stability of sodium rabeprazole was alleviated.

关 键 词:雷贝拉唑钠 离子交换树脂 药物树脂复合物 稳定性
